Determining Goals and Objectives: The Foundation of a Solid Plan

Steve, many people find the estate planning process daunting. Where should someone begin?

That’s a great question, Brenda. Ordinarily, I advise clients to start with determining their goals and objectives. What do they envision for their assets after they’re gone? Do they have specific wishes regarding how their property is distributed? Are there any charitable organizations they want to support? Understanding these fundamental desires allows us to craft a plan that truly reflects their values.

Consequently, clarifying your goals helps prioritize who receives what and under what conditions. For instance, a young parent might prioritize ensuring their children are financially secure should something happen to them, while someone nearing retirement may focus on minimizing estate taxes or leaving a legacy for future generations.

Moreover, clearly defining these objectives ensures that everyone involved understands the plan’s purpose and minimizes potential disputes down the road. It’s about creating peace of mind and protecting your loved ones. It’s estimated that over 60% of adults in the U.S. don’t have a will or trust in place (AARP, 2023). This lack of planning can lead to unintended consequences and family disagreements during an already difficult time.

I recall meeting with a couple who had been together for decades but never formally discussed their estate plans. When the husband unexpectedly passed away, his wife was left navigating complex legal issues without clear guidance on his wishes. It was a heartbreaking situation that could have been mitigated with open communication and proper planning.
